Description

Quaternions are a simple and powerful tool for handling rotations and double groups. This book gives a complete treatment of finite point groups as subgroups of the full rotation group and emphasizes geometrical and topological methods which permit a unique definition of the quaternion parameters for all operations of such groups. An important feature of the book is an elementary but comprehensive discussion of projective representations and their application to the spinor representations. This gives great advantages in conciseness and precision over the more classicl double group method. The treatment throughout is self-contained although some familiarity with elementary group theory is assumed.
